Paper thickness varies. Typically, 100 sheets are about 1 cm thick. Atoms typically vary from 1 to 3 angstroms in radius. (An angstrom is 10 −10 m.) Suppose a piece of paper is 0.0072 cm thick. How many atoms span the thickness if the radius of the atom is 1.23 angstroms?
